XML 97 R80.htm IDEA: XBRL DOCUMENT v3.24.1.1.u2
Derivatives And Hedging Activities (Effect Of Derivative Financial Instruments On The Consolidated Balance Sheets) (Details) - USD ($)
$ in Thousands
Mar. 31, 2024
Mar. 31, 2023
Derivative [Line Items]    
Derivatives in a Fair Value Asset Position Designated as Hedging Instruments $ 6,783 $ 7,102
Derivatives in a Fair Value Liability Position Designated as Hedging Instruments 9 3,967
Derivatives in a Fair Value Asset Position Not Designated as Hedging Instruments 245 1,320
Derivatives in a Fair Value Liability Position Not Designated as Hedging Instruments 12 435
Forward Foreign Currency Exchange Contracts [Member] | Other Current Assets [Member]    
Derivative [Line Items]    
Derivatives in a Fair Value Asset Position Designated as Hedging Instruments 77 7,102
Derivatives in a Fair Value Asset Position Not Designated as Hedging Instruments 245 1,320
Forward Foreign Currency Exchange Contracts [Member] | Accounts Payable And Accrued Expenses [Member]    
Derivative [Line Items]    
Derivatives in a Fair Value Liability Position Designated as Hedging Instruments 9 890
Derivatives in a Fair Value Liability Position Not Designated as Hedging Instruments 12 435
Cash Flow Hedges [Member] | Interest Rate Swap Agreements [Member] | Other Non-Current Assets [Member]    
Derivative [Line Items]    
Derivatives in a Fair Value Asset Position Designated as Hedging Instruments 6,706 0
Cash Flow Hedges [Member] | Interest Rate Swap Agreements [Member] | Other Noncurrent Liabilities [Member]    
Derivative [Line Items]    
Derivatives in a Fair Value Liability Position Designated as Hedging Instruments $ 0 $ 3,077